DHL Controls Costs and Increases Satisfaction
DHL Supply Chain of North America looked at every angle to bring down consumable and label costs. The answer was a consolidation plan that lead to better plan budgets, consistent label quality, cost-effective purchasing and an estimated $273,000 savings.
